Jazz Pharmaceuticals Ireland Limited v. Tevapharmaceuticals, Inc.
Infringement action filed 21 Mar 2023 in the United States District Court for the District of New Jersey and closed 15 Dec 2023, with 13 patents asserted. Recorded basis of termination: case consolidated.

Gamma-hydroxybutyrate compositions and their uses for the treatment of disorders
Provided herein are pharmaceutical compositions and formulations comprising mixed salts of gamma-hydroxybutyrate (GHB). Also provided herein are methods of making the pharmaceutical compositions and formulations, and methods of their use for the treatment of sleep disorders such as apnea, sleep time disturbances, narcolepsy, cataplexy, sleep paralysis, hypnagogic hallucination, sleep arousal, insomnia, and nocturnal myoclonus.

Basis of termination
From the record · verbatim“WHEREAS, Plaintiff Jazz Pharmaceuticals Ireland Limited (“Jazz”) filed Civil Action No. 21-14271 in this Judicial District against Defendants Lupin Ltd., Lupin Inc., and Lupin Pharmaceuticals, Inc. (Lupin Inc. and Lupin Pharmaceuticals, Inc. are together, “Lupin”) on July 28, 2021; WHEREAS, the Court dismissed Lupin Ltd. from Civil Action No. 21-14271 on March 16, 2022 (D.I. 40); WHEREAS, the Court consolidated Civil Action No. 21-14271 with (1) related Civil Action No. 22-2773 on June 22, 2022, and (2) related Civil Action No. 23-329 on February 15, 2023 (see Civil Action No. 21-14271, D.I. 47 & 81); WHEREAS, Jazz filed Civil Action No. 23-1617 in this Judicial District against Defendant Teva Pharmaceuticals, Inc. (“Teva”) on March 21, 2023; WHEREAS, the Court ordered Jazz and Teva to submit a joint letter on or before January 5, 2024 addressing, inter alia, “the parties’ respective positions on whether consolidation with the Case 2:23-cv-01617-SRC-JSA Document 53 Filed 12/15/23 Page 1 of 4 PageID: 1152 2 case captioned Jazz Pharmaceuticals Ireland, Limited v. Lupin Inc., et al., Civil Action No. 21-cv14271 (SRC) (consolidated) is appropriate at this juncture” (Civil Action No. 23-1617, D.I. 50); WHEREAS, Jazz, Lupin, and Teva conferred and agree, subject to the Court’s approval, that Civil Action Nos. 21-14271 and 23-1617 should be consolidated for all purposes; IT IS on this 15th day of December, 2023, for good cause shown, ORDERED that Civil Action Nos. 21-14271 and 23-1617 (the “Consolidated Actions”) are consolidated for all purposes, including discovery, case management, and trial, subject to further order of the Court; IT IS FURTHER ORDERED that Jazz and Teva shall be bound by the Stipulated Discovery Confidentiality Order entered by the Court on August 7, 2023 (Civil Action No. 23- 1617, D.I. 36); IT IS FURTHER ORDERED that all filings in the Consolidated Actions shall use the above caption on this Order; IT IS FURTHER ORDERED that all filings going forward shall be filed in Civil Action No. 21-14271, and that Civil Action No. 23-1617 shall be terminated by the Clerk’s office for administrative purposes only”
